Transaction

d2186b5ed280f82f75ebed6d8100c02513ef603959ed146ffdee54f246852dfd
407,920 confirmations
Timestamp
1530438733
Block530,027
Fee11,300 sats
Fee rate50 sats/vB
view on mempool.space

Inputs & Outputs